AAR AHB1 26 March 2011
« on: March 27, 2011, 08:15:27 am »
With the weather looking ominous, it was touch and go whether we would play, but thankfully it held so we could get in a solid days gaming - apart from a few minor drops. Thankfully noone wussed out, and we managed to have the biggest turnout at an AHB game yet - with 99% of us being AHB members!! 20 Players all up!! Nice job.

Everyone had a blast, and luckily we had enough airsoft guns to go around. Thanks to those that dug into their personal caches to help out. We have a couple more club guns inbound :)

We played in one of the newer areas we've found at AHB1, and having those two defendable mounds at each end provided us with a good field. Plenty of cover, some open areas for maneuver, and even a giant stump in the middle, which was a cover magnet, and a BB magnet.... Good Times.

Thanks to Johnsy for representing TAR. Also, welcome to another ex-aucklander, Pancho. Thanks Windos for bringing out your Prop Bomb Mk2. The two games we used it in were excellent fun.

Anyway, enough of my rambling. Here's the pics (There's a few, so I've split em across posts):
